What is Twisted Bridge Dubai?

The Twisted Bridge is one of the three pedestrian bridges built under the Water Canal development project. It has a double Helix structure that twists creating a structure like the infinity symbol. It is about 460 feet long and suspended  8.5 meters/28 feet above the water. Plus the aluminum frames clad the length of the bridge to create the monumental twisted layout. It was originally called Bridge 03 but the name Twisted Bridge became popular because of its rather unique design.

Its construction was completed in 2017 and since then millions of tourists have visited it. Additionally, Twisted Bridge has won several awards for its design. Conde Nast Traveller, a luxurious travel magazine,  included Twisted Bridge in its list of the world’s most beautiful bridges. The fluid and futuristic design symbolizes the dynamic future of Dubai. 

What is the location of Twisted Bridge?  

Twisted Bridge is located at 75 22C St over the Dubai Water Canal near Jumeirah, Dubai. The peculiar structure resembling the infinity symbol (∞) of the bridge will be visible from afar when you are in Jumeirah so you will have no problem finding it.

History of Twisted Bridge Dubai

The Twisted Bridge was designed by Ismail Kerem Şerifoğlu and Tamer Fawzi Ismail. They started their studies and careers together in the design studios of the American University of Sharjah’s (AUS) College of Architecture, Art and Design (CAAD). They along with their wives are award-winning architects, interior designers, and visual artists. 

Right after graduating, they took over and executed a $1.3 billion project which involved developing an Autodrome and modern showroom, etc. They went on to design many other major commercial, hospitality, healthcare, commercial, and educational projects all over the Gulf region. 

One of their major projects was called Dubai Water Canal Development. They started working on it in 2014 and completed it in 2017. It aimed to connect Dubai Creek to the Arabian Gulf but this project cut one side of Dubai to the other. To solve this problem, these three pedestrian bridges were built.  Kerem and Tamer lead the team that built these bridges. All three bridges have striking and impressive structures but Twisted Bridge takes the crown. Its twisting truss design is spectacular and remarkable.

Both Kerem and Tamer consider the Three Bridges to be their most glorious architectural collaboration. Unfortunately, this project was their last project together. Kerem died shortly after this project was completed. This is the reason the backstory of the bridges is considered tragic. The story of Kerem moved many across the globe. But Kerem’s legacy lives on through the Three Bridges and Tamer.

When Does Twisted Bridge Open?

The Twisted Bridge is open 24/7 for visitors and locals. It is a pedestrian bridge so it has to be open all day and night for the use of the general public. Sometimes photographers and videographers visit Twisted Bridge at night to take shots of skyscrapers and the Promenade of Dubai at night. There is no fee to use this pedestrian bridge.

What is the Dress Code for the Twisted Bridge? 

There is no official dress code to visit the Twisted Bridge. But Dubai is situated in UAE which is a Muslim country. That means most of the natives are practicing Muslims. You should dress appropriately to show your respect for the local culture. The heat of Dubai should also be considered when you put together your outfit. You should cover your legs to your knees and avoid wearing revealing tops.

We recommend a long flowy dress or a top of your choice with pants for women. Men should wear shirts and bottoms that cover their legs to the knees. You should carry hats, shades, or umbrellas to protect yourself from UV rays.
